AbstractThe complicated nature of oil and gas projects demands the deployment of integrated and effective project management methodologies to achieve the project objectives. However, the availability of alternative methods, high rate of project failure, and limited available resources can make decision making a challenge for project managers. The main purpose of this research is to provide insight to project managers and oil and gas companies on the effect of PMBOK knowledge areas on critical success factors in oil and gas industry in Iran. Two pre-existing survey questionnaires (PIP and PMPQ) are used to collect data on demographic information, PMBOK knowledge areas and critical success factors. A total of 100 questionnaires were distributed among project managers, senior managers and project experts in oil and gas organizations in Iran and 72 acceptable responses were received and analyzed through structural equation modelling (SEM). The overall positive relationship between the variables are observed. The results of SEM analysis indicated that the scope management is the most effective knowledge area with the weight equals to 0.855 followed by communication management and risk management with the weights equal to 0.818 and 0.756 respectively.
